Acts upstream of or within several processes, including animal organ development; neuroblast migration; and roof of mouth development. Predicted to be located in nucleoplasm and plasma membrane. Predicted to be active in chromatin and nucleus. Is expressed in several structures, including alimentary system; brain; genitourinary system; integumental system; and sensory organ. Used to study Cornelia de Lange syndrome. Orthologous to human PDS5A (PDS5 cohesin associated factor A). [provided by Alliance of Genome Resources, Apr 2022]
